At its core, blockchain is a distributed, immutable ledger that records transactions across many computers. This decentralized nature is its superpower. Unlike traditional financial systems that rely on central authorities like banks and governments, blockchain operates on a peer-to-peer network. This means no single entity has complete control, making it inherently more transparent, secure, and resistant to censorship or manipulation. Imagine a world where your financial records are not held by a single institution susceptible to breaches or internal control, but are instead shared and verified by a vast network of participants. This is the promise of blockchain.

Decentralized Finance, or DeFi, built on blockchain protocols, is creating a parallel financial system that is open, permissionless, and accessible to anyone with an internet connection. DeFi applications allow individuals to lend, borrow, trade, and earn interest on their digital assets without the need for traditional financial intermediaries. This can lead to significantly higher yields on savings compared to traditional bank accounts, and provides access to credit for individuals who might be excluded from conventional lending systems due to credit history or location. Smart contracts, self-executing contracts with the terms of the agreement directly written into code, automate these processes, ensuring transparency and efficiency.

The rise of stablecoins, cryptocurrencies pegged to stable assets like the US dollar, offers a crucial bridge between the volatile world of crypto and the need for reliable value. For individuals looking to safeguard their wealth from inflation or participate in the DeFi ecosystem without exposure to extreme price swings, stablecoins provide a secure and accessible digital store of value. They allow for seamless transactions within the blockchain, earning interest through lending protocols, or simply holding funds securely without the constant worry of market fluctuations that plague other digital assets. The concept of "yield farming" and "staking" within the crypto space, while requiring a degree of technical understanding and risk assessment, presents innovative ways to generate passive income. Staking involves locking up certain cryptocurrencies to support the operations of a blockchain network in exchange for rewards. Yield farming involves providing liquidity to decentralized exchanges or lending protocols to earn fees and interest. These mechanisms, powered by smart contracts, allow individuals to put their digital assets to work, generating income streams that can significantly accelerate their journey towards financial independence. The Role of Zero-Knowledge Proofs
At the heart of ZK-P2P Payments Compliance Edge are zero-knowledge proofs, a cryptographic method that allows one party (the prover) to prove to another party (the verifier) that a certain statement is true, without revealing any additional information apart from the fact that the statement is indeed true.
In the context of P2P payments, this means that a user can prove they have the funds to make a payment and that they comply with all relevant regulations, without revealing any details about their identity or financial status. This is achieved through sophisticated algorithms that generate proofs which are both verifiable and inscrutable.

Scalability and Efficiency
One of the significant challenges in blockchain technology is scalability. Traditional blockchain networks often suffer from slow transaction speeds and high fees, particularly during periods of high network congestion. ZK-P2P Payments Compliance Edge addresses these issues through the use of zk-SNARKs (Zero-Knowledge Succinct Non-Interactive Argument of Knowledge) and zk-STARKs (Zero-Knowledge Scalable Transparent Argument of Knowledge).
These advanced zero-knowledge proof systems offer several advantages:
Succinctness: zk-SNARKs and zk-STARKs produce proofs that are much smaller in size compared to traditional proofs, which significantly speeds up verification times and reduces storage requirements. Scalability: The scalable nature of these proof systems allows for faster and more efficient transaction processing, even during periods of high network activity. Transparency: These proofs are transparent and verifiable by anyone, ensuring that the compliance verification process is both secure and trustworthy.
